Funding details:
£6,000 a year for up to three years for an undergraduate student. Up to £10,000 awarded against tuition fees for one year of study for a postgraduate student.

Selection criteria:
You must:
- Hold a firm offer to study a new full-time course in 2025/26, excluding foundation year and distance learning, in BA(Hons) Textiles in Practice.
- Have a household income of £25,000 or less. We'll check this against your Student Finance application. Please contact us if you will not be applying to Student Finance for a maintenance loan.
- Be a UK student - English, Scottish, Welsh or Northern Irish - paying the standard full-time fees, and have a UK Student Support Number.
- Pay for your course yourself, including through a student loan or a payment from your parents. Your course fees must not be paid by a business, charity or other organisation.
Postgraduate
You must:
Hold a firm offer to study a new full-time course in 2025/26, excluding distance learning, in MA/MSc Textiles.
Prove your gross income was £25,000 or less in the previous financial year. We'll accept:
- P60s
- Student Finance Entitlement Letters
- A self-employment tax return
Be a UK student - English, Scottish, Welsh or Northern Irish - paying the standard full-time fees, and have a UK Student Support Number.
Pay for your course yourself, including through a student loan or a payment from your parents. Your course fees must not be paid by a business, charity or other organisation.
You'll need to:
- Complete the application form.
- Add a link to your digital portfolio. You can use your admissions portfolio, but it's a good idea to update it with your latest work.
- Postgraduate applicants will need to upload financial evidence for the 2024/25 tax year.
